- StarCosmozMay 21, 2022 · 4 years agoIf you're looking for a wallet that supports a specific cryptocurrency, it's worth checking if the official wallet for that coin is available. Many cryptocurrencies have their own official wallets, which are often designed to provide the best compatibility and security for that particular coin. These wallets usually offer features specific to the coin, such as staking or voting. So, if you have a favorite cryptocurrency, it's worth exploring if it has an official wallet that meets your needs.

- Ayush PandeyJun 24, 2024 · 2 years agoWhile there are many great crypto wallets out there, it's important to remember that no wallet is 100% secure. It's always recommended to follow best practices for securing your cryptocurrencies, such as enabling two-factor authentication, keeping your wallet software up to date, and storing your recovery phrase in a safe place. By taking these precautions, you can enhance the security of your crypto assets, regardless of the wallet you choose.
